TV's longest-running comedy surpasses the quarter-century mark.
October 4, 2013
FOX announced today that The Simpsons has been renewed for a 26th season, extending the animated comedy's run past the quarter-century mark. On the air since 1989, the show also holds the distinction of being television's longest-running prime time scripted series in history.
UPDATE: Season 26 of The Simpsons will premiere on Sunday, September 28, 2014 at 8:00pm.
